当前位置:主页 > 软件资讯 > 有哪些好用的软件安全测试工具推荐吗?

有哪些好用的软件安全测试工具推荐吗?

文章来源:未知 作者:礁石游戏网 发布时间:2024-11-21 16:38

一、有哪些好用的软件安全测试工具推荐吗?

1. AppScan

一款安全漏洞扫描测试工具,可支持支持Web和移动端,可生成很直观的测试报告,有助于软件开发人员进行分析和修复,使用较方便。

2. Burp Suite

一款测试人员必备的集成型渗透测试工具,采用自动测试和半自动测试的方式,可对web应用程序进行自动化攻击等,通过拦截HTTP/HTTPS的web数据包,充当应用程序和浏览器的中间方,进行拦截、重放、修改数据包进行测试,是web安全人员的一把必备的测试神器。

3. nessus

一款世界上流行的的漏洞扫描程序测试工具,可以提供完整的电脑漏洞扫描服务,并随时更新其漏洞数据库。支持同时在本机或远端上遥控,进行系统的漏洞分析扫描。

4. Excercise in a Box

一款在线安全测试工具,可测试网络是否容易遭受到攻击,支持提供各种场景,反复演练自身面对安全攻击事件的响应能力,包含了需要执行的各种计划、交付、设置、以及事后整改活动等资源。

为了更好的保障软件产品的安全质量,当然是找更靠谱的第三方软件测试机构进行测试工作了。卓码软件测评,具备CMA、CNAS双重资质认证,可出具国家认可的具备法律效力的软件测试报告。专注于软件测试多年,测试团队实战经验丰富、技术成熟,线上线下全国范围内均可服务。

二、网络安全测试工具有哪些呢?网络安全测试工具?

解决网络安全问题的主要途径和方法如下:

1、防范网络病毒。

2、配置防火墙。

3、采用入侵检测系统。

4、Web、Emai1、BBS的安全监测系统。

5、漏洞扫描系统。

6、IP盗用问题的解决。

7、利用网络维护子网系统安全。

8、提高网络工作人员的素质,强化网络安全责任。

三、app测试软件工具

App测试软件工具在现代软件开发过程中扮演着至关重要的角色。随着移动应用成为人们生活不可或缺的一部分,保证应用程序的质量和稳定性变得尤为重要。在这篇文章中,我们将重点讨论一些流行的App测试软件工具,探讨它们的特点和用途。

Appium

Appium是一个用于自动化移动应用程序的开源工具。它支持多种平台,包括iOS和Android,并且可以使用多种编程语言编写测试脚本。Appium的强大之处在于其灵活性和跨平台性,使得开发人员能够轻松地创建和运行测试用例,从而确保应用程序的稳定性和性能。

MonkeyRunner

MonkeyRunner是由Google提供的用于Android应用程序测试的工具。它可以模拟用户在设备上的操作,如点击、滑动等,从而帮助开发人员检测应用程序在不同情况下的表现。MonkeyRunner的优势在于其简单易用的界面和灵活性,使得测试人员能够快速编写测试脚本并执行测试。

XCTest

XCTest是苹果提供的用于iOS应用程序测试的框架。它结合了单元测试和UI测试,可以帮助开发人员全面地测试其应用程序的各个方面。XCTest具有丰富的断言库和调试工具,可以帮助开发人员快速定位并修复问题,从而提高应用程序的质量。

Robot Framework

Robot Framework是一个通用的自动化测试框架,可以用于测试各种应用程序,包括移动应用。它支持关键字驱动的测试方法,使得测试用例的编写变得简单和直观。Robot Framework还具有丰富的插件和扩展,可以满足不同测试需求。

Selenium

Selenium是一个用于Web应用程序测试的工具,但也可以被用于移动应用测试。通过结合Appium和Selenium Grid,开发人员可以实现跨平台的自动化测试,从而提高测试覆盖范围和效率。Selenium的灵活性和强大的定位方法使得测试人员能够轻松地模拟用户操作并检测应用程序的问题。

Calabash

Calabash是一个用于自动化iOS和Android应用程序测试的开源框架。它基于Cucumber测试框架,提供了易于理解的自然语言和可重用的测试步骤。Calabash的特点在于其直观的语法和丰富的插件生态系统,可以帮助开发人员快速构建稳定的测试用例。

JUnit

JUnit是一个用于Java应用程序测试的单元测试框架。虽然它主要用于Web应用程序的测试,但也可以被用于移动应用程序的测试。JUnit提供了丰富的断言和测试运行器,可以帮助开发人员编写可靠的测试用例并快速执行测试。

Espresso

Espresso是Android提供的用于UI测试的框架。它结合了简洁的语法和强大的断言功能,可以帮助开发人员编写清晰和稳健的UI测试。Espresso的快速执行速度和可靠性使得测试人员能够快速验证应用程序在不同设备上的表现。

总的来说,选择合适的App测试软件工具对于确保应用程序的质量和性能至关重要。不同的工具具有不同的特点和适用范围,开发人员应根据自身需求和技术栈选择合适的测试工具。通过有效地利用这些工具,开发团队可以提高应用程序的稳定性,减少bug的数量,从而提升用户体验和满意度。

四、汽车软件测试工具

汽车软件测试工具的重要性与应用

汽车软件测试一直是汽车行业中非常重要的环节,它对于确保汽车的安全性、可靠性和性能至关重要。为了提高测试的效率和精度,汽车软件测试工具也成为了汽车制造商和技术公司的关注点。

汽车软件测试工具是为了辅助开发人员和测试人员进行汽车软件测试而开发的软件。它们能够自动化测试过程,并提供详细的测试报告和分析结果。以下是一些常见的汽车软件测试工具:

  • RhinoMocks: RhinoMocks是一个强大的单元测试工具,它可以帮助开发人员模拟和测试汽车软件中的各种操作和功能。
  • Selenium: Selenium是一个广泛使用的Web应用程序测试工具,它可以用于自动化测试汽车软件中的Web界面和功能。
  • CANoe: CANoe是用于测试汽车网络通信和诊断的工具,它可以模拟不同的通信协议和网络环境。
  • VectorCAST: VectorCAST是一种基于模型的软件测试工具,它可以对汽车软件进行静态和动态分析,并生成全面的测试报告。

使用这些汽车软件测试工具可以带来多方面的好处。首先,它们可以提高测试的效率和准确性。传统的手动测试方法需要大量的人力和时间投入,而自动化测试工具可以大大简化测试流程,减少人力资源的消耗。

其次,汽车软件测试工具可以提供详细的测试报告和分析结果。这些报告可以帮助开发人员找出软件缺陷和性能问题,并及时进行修复和优化。同时,测试工具还可以监控测试覆盖率,确保所有的功能和代码路径都得到了充分测试。

此外,汽车软件测试工具还可以帮助开发人员进行自动化回归测试。在软件开发过程中,经常需要对已有的功能进行修改和优化,这可能引入新的问题。自动化回归测试可以确保修改不会破坏原有的功能,从而提高软件的稳定性和可靠性。

不仅如此,汽车软件测试工具还可以支持软件开发流程中的持续集成和持续交付。通过集成测试工具和版本控制系统,开发人员可以实现自动化的构建和测试,提高软件的交付速度和质量。

总而言之,汽车软件测试工具在现代汽车制造业中发挥着重要作用。它们不仅可以提高测试效率和准确性,还可以提供详细的测试报告和分析结果,帮助开发人员修复软件缺陷和优化性能。此外,测试工具还可以支持持续集成和持续交付,提高软件的交付速度和质量。因此,汽车制造商和技术公司应该积极采用汽车软件测试工具,以确保汽车软件的安全、可靠和高效。

五、求软件测试工具下载地址?

福利来啦!更新一波软件下载链接,经测有效!

有的,看这个就行

六、手机软件测试工具有哪些?

1、QC、bugfree、禅道

2、LR、QTP、jmeter

3、tomcat、apache、IIS

4、Py、js

5、SVN、Git

6、mysql、oracle

7、最新的,可以到海枫科技官网查询一下 独孤码农

七、想学软件测试,大家推荐哪款工具?

知道你打算学哪种软件测试工具,不过就目前软件测试发展的趋势来看,比较流行的就是惠普的自动化测试工具Loadrunner、QTP,现在越来越多的企业在用这些工具进行测试,很多企业也重视员工对这些工具的掌握程度。如果你致力于在软件测试这个行业发展,做一名资深的软件测试工程师,这两个工具学会了是很有帮助的。

我一个朋友参加了广东软件评测中心举办的这些测试工具的培训,反应效果很不过,师资都是惠普那边的老师,你要是想在广州学习与工作的话,可以上网去查查那个培训单位,说不定会对你很有帮助的哦。

八、软件测试主要是用哪些工具呢?

常用的软件测试工具一般是:QTP+LoadRunner+QC软件测试中还需的工具如下:一般测试流程:

九、安全工具软件有哪些?

试试腾讯电脑管家,加入全球著名的小红伞病毒查杀引擎,极大提升了电脑管家的木马病毒查杀性能,而木马病毒查杀性能的提升又必将进一步提升管家的整体性能,体验更加卓越腾讯电脑管家已经发展成为一款全能型的系统安全辅助工具,好用又免费,绝对可以称得上是一个难得的安全软件

十、Mac 硬盘测试软件-选择最佳工具保障数据安全

Mac 硬盘测试软件:选择最佳工具保障数据安全

在使用Mac电脑的过程中,硬盘问题是一个不能忽视的重要因素。无论是日常使用还是专业工作,我们都希望自己的Mac硬盘能保持良好的状态,以避免数据丢失和系统崩溃。为了及时发现硬盘问题并采取相应的措施,我们可以使用Mac硬盘测试软件。

所谓硬盘测试软件,就是一种专业工具,用于检测Mac硬盘的健康状况和性能状态。它可以帮助我们发现硬盘中的错误扇区、坏道、慢速磁道以及其他问题,并提供可行的解决方案。通过定期进行硬盘测试,我们可以提前发现潜在的硬盘故障,采取相应的预防和修复措施,从而有效降低数据丢失的风险。

在选择Mac 硬盘测试软件时,我们需要考虑以下几个因素:

  1. 功能丰富:好的Mac硬盘测试软件应当具备全面的功能,包括智能扫描、表面扫描、低级格式化等。它应该能够检测各种类型的硬盘问题,并提供可靠的修复方案。
  2. 易于使用:对于大部分用户来说,操作简单易懂的软件更受欢迎。一款好的Mac硬盘测试软件应该具备友好的用户界面和直观的操作逻辑,让用户能够轻松上手,进行必要的测试操作。
  3. 稳定可靠:在选择Mac硬盘测试软件时,我们应该选取那些经过严格测试和验证的工具。它们应该能够稳定运行,并保证数据的安全性。
  4. 兼容性:由于Mac电脑中使用的是苹果自家的操作系统,我们需要确保所选的硬盘测试软件与Mac系统兼容,并且能够适应不同型号的Mac硬件。

根据以上要求,市面上有一些值得推荐的Mac硬盘测试软件。其中,常见的有Disk Utility(硬盘实用工具)、TechTool Pro、DriveDx等。它们都具备强大的功能和良好的口碑,被广大Mac用户广泛应用。

总之,选择一款适合自己需求的Mac硬盘测试软件,对于保障数据安全和硬件持久性都至关重要。通过定期进行硬盘测试,我们可以在问题变得严重之前采取措施,避免数据丢失和系统崩溃。希望本篇文章能够帮助你更好地了解Mac硬盘测试软件,选择最佳的工具,保障数据安全。

感谢您阅读本文,如果您有任何关于Mac硬盘测试软件的问题或其他相关话题,欢迎留言交流!